In Bioco Medico, we develop the next generation medical adhesives, inspired by how the blue mussel attaches under water. Our technology platform is based on biocompatible and biodegradable materials, and we develop innovative adhesive materials with tunable elasticity and ability to cure in fully wet conditions. www.biocomedico.com

Materials science research, with focus on the structure and function of bone on various length scales. We use high resolution techniques like Electron Microscopy, Nanoindentation and Nano Computed Tomography to characterize bone down to the nanometer level.
